Fall is one of our favorite times to be on the water. Changing colors and landscapes, hungry fish, and fewer people on the river are among the many reasons we love the season.

There's no question that the weather conditions during fall in the Rockies can vary quite a bit over the course of a day out on the water, so proper layering is key to staying comfortable and productive on the water, especially while you're ripping streamers.

With that in mind, here are five essentials pieces of gear you need for the upcoming season.

SIMMS MIDSTREAM INSULATED VEST

Vests and fall go together like brown trout and streamers. The new line of Midstream Insulated pieces, including the Midstream Insulated Jacket and the Midstream Insulated Pullover, features PrimaLoft Gold for the highest warmth-to-weight ratio available with synthetic insulation. That means you can stay comfortable in the cold without being over-bundled and rendered immobile with thick, heavy layering. The Midstream Insulated series has a smooth Pertex face to stop the wind, as well.

SIMMS ULTRA-WOOL CORE BOTTOM

We've been wet wading all summer, but it's time to get real. Water temperatures and air temperatures are going to start to fall and nothing ends your day quicker than some cold legs. The new SIMMS Ultra-Wool Core Bottom is a great foundation to the proper fall layering system. The odor-resistant wool blend is soft against the skin and breathes naturally to keep you dry and warm in a wide range of temperatures and conditions. Looking to complete the Ultra-Wool Core Layering system, check out the Simms Ultra-Wool Core Top.

SIMMS G3 GUIDE STOCKINGFOOT RIVER CAMO WADERS

Fall generally means low water. Low water means spookier fish. If you're looking for that extra advantage, look no further than the Simms G3 Stockingfoot River Camo Waders. SIMMS collaborated with Veil Camo to design the first camo that helps anglers remain unseen by fish. Combine that Veil Camo with the industry standard 4-layer GORE-TEX and you've got a fall essential through and through.

SCIENTIFIC ANGLERS SONAR TITAN INT / SINK 3 / SINK 5 FLY LINE

Stripping streamers for those big fall trophies, the Sonar Titan INT/SINK3/SINK 5 Fly Line from Scientific Anglers is a triple-density sinking fly line that casts like a floating line. This fly line provides a straight-line connection to your streamer and allows you to leave the chucking and ducking in the past.

SIMMS RIVERBANK PULL-ON BOOT/SIMMS RIVERBANK CHUKKA BOOT

Fall in your drift boat just got a lot more comfortable. The Pull-On Boot is fully waterproof and insulated, so it gets you from the truck to the bank to the boat - and back again and keeps you comfortable the entire time.
